Mitty noun. M20.
[from Walter Mitty, hero of James Thurber's short story The Secret Life of Walter Mitty.]
A person who indulges in daydreams, esp. of a life much more exciting and glamorous than his or her real life.
Mitty'esque adjective M20.

utriculosaccular duct


A duct that connects the inner aspect of the utricle with the endolymphatic duct a short distance from its origin from the saccule.

Synonym: ductus utriculosaccularis, Bottcher's canal.
